QUICK YEAST ROLLS | |
5 3/4 c. all purpose flour 2 pkgs. dry yeast 2 tbsp. sugar 1 tbsp. salt 1/4 c. soft butter 2 1/4 c. very hot tap water 1. Combine 2 3/4 cups of flour, dry yeast, sugar, soft butter, salt and hot tap water in large mixing bowl. 2. Mix all ingredients together on #5 (medium speed) for 2 1/2 minutes. Scrape sides and bottom of bowl. 3. Add 1 cup flour to mixture. Beat on #10 (high speed) for 1 minute. 4. Work in remaining flour with wooden spoon. Turn out onto floured board. Knead 5 to 10 minutes. Let rest 20 minutes. 5. Punch down dough. Shape into rolls. Brush top of rolls with melted butter. Cover with cloth. Refrigerate 2 to 24 hours. 6. Remove from refrigerator 10 minutes before baking. Bake at 400 degrees, hot oven, for 15 minutes or until done. Makes 3 dozen. |
